240D rebuilt Longblock

Hello,

I bought a 240D, and the owner claimed it had a "crate" motor. I have attached a picture of the label on the valve cover. I just barely brought it home. I wanted the group to help me understand this label.

Could this possibly be a Mercedes long block? a factory or dealer rebuilt?

That is the part number for a "Basismotor", which I think translates to a long block. About $3500 plus $1800 core.

I saw one of those with a Metric Motors tag in a 240D in the wrecking yard. It looked like a brand new engine, but I think the valve cover had a hole in it and the camshaft was broken. Such a shame. It still may have been a good engine if the valves and camshaft were replaced.

Mark82--short block means something like just the block without the head, while a long block would be a complete engine and possibly with injection pump.
